For 144 years, we’ve been a physical and spiritual sanctuary, empowering the homeless, hungry and hurting. Whether it's providing a clean bed, preparing a warm meal, offering medical care, helping with legal needs, or assisting with long-term housing, we serve everyone unconditionally with excellence and dignity so that they experience a safe refuge from the streets along with a welcoming sense of belonging. Join us as we open our doors 365 days a year to activate others' God-given potential.

In 1878, The Sunday Breakfast Association of Philadelphia was established. More than 250 men attended the first meeting, where coffee and rolls were served before church. In 2022, having expanded well beyond the initial purpose of serving breakfast to men on Sunday morning, we changed our name to Philly House to better represent the broad spectrum of ways we serve the community. Today, we are the city’s largest and longest-running shelter, providing a safe, clean refuge off the streets with the goal of long-term impact. ???? #PhillyHouseFriday https://ow.ly/9JoP50Vjbuh

After nearly 30 rehab attempts, Julio learned the hard way that facing addiction alone wouldn’t lead to change. But with Philly House, he found a supportive family and a purpose. Now clean, he's regained custody of his daughter & served over 2 MILLION meals as one of our chefs! ????? Every day, he strives to be the best dad possible, proving recovery is about connection & love. Read his full story here: https://ow.ly/l5Rn50VcNLI #FacesOfPhilly #HopeLivesHere
